Top Phlebotomy Job Positions in Tampa, FL
Here’s a list of some of the most sought-after phlebotomy roles in Tampa’s healthcare facilities:
1. Certified Phlebotomist
Most entry-level phlebotomy positions require certification and involve collecting blood samples, preparing specimens, and maintaining patient comfort and safety.
2.Phlebotomy Technician
Often employed in hospitals and laboratories, these technicians perform blood draws, manage specimen labeling, and assist with sample storage.
3. Lead Phlebotomist
Assuming supervisory roles, lead phlebotomists oversee daily operations, train new staff, and ensure compliance with safety protocols.
4. Mobile Phlebotomist
This role involves traveling to patient homes or workplaces to perform blood collection, providing convenience and accessible healthcare services.

Practical Tips to Secure a Phlebotomy Job in Tampa
- Obtain Certification: Ensure you have RPT (Registered Phlebotomy Technician) certification from recognized bodies like the National Healthcare Association or American Society for Clinical Pathology.
- Gain Hands-On Experience: Volunteer or complete internships at local clinics or hospitals to boost your resume.
- Develop Soft Skills: Empathy, interaction, and patience are crucial when dealing with anxious patients.
- Network Locally: Attend healthcare job fairs and join local professional associations to connect with Tampa employers.
- Stay Updated: Continue your education with advanced courses to maintain certifications and learn new techniques.
